Naughty Bites Podcast Season 1: Episode 6: Challenging Stereotypes and Woman Empowerment with Sharan Dhaliwal

 

As a South Asian woman, what stereotypes have you had or experienced? What gives you the courage to dissect subjects on culture, queerness and womanhood? What makes you whole?

This episode of the Naughty Bites Podcast explores the personal and social impact of women stereotypes in the South Asian community through honest confessions, real experiences and unexpected realisations with Sharan Dhaliwal, the founder of South Asian publication Burnt Rot and author of Burning My Roti. We delve into her queer coming of age experiences, colourism, and her own navigation of British-Indian cultural intersections.
